fix: spacing between statuses and cards, tag labels

This commit is contained in:
2025-03-12 00:59:13 +04:00
parent 98266a8a8f
commit 7dcb646b82
4 changed files with 19 additions and 19 deletions

View File

@@ -61,11 +61,6 @@ const Board = ({ board }: Props) => {
<div <div
{...provided.droppableProps} {...provided.droppableProps}
ref={provided.innerRef} ref={provided.innerRef}
onMouseEnter={() => {
if (dragState === DragState.DRAG_CARD) {
setSelectedBoard(board);
}
}}
> >
<Draggable <Draggable
draggableId={"board-" + board.id.toString()} draggableId={"board-" + board.id.toString()}

View File

@@ -1,4 +1,4 @@
import { Center, Checkbox, Group, Menu, Pill, rem, Stack, Text } from "@mantine/core"; import { Center, Checkbox, Group, Menu, Pill, rem, Stack } from "@mantine/core";
import { CardTagSchema, CardTagService } from "../../../../client"; import { CardTagSchema, CardTagService } from "../../../../client";
import { IconPlus } from "@tabler/icons-react"; import { IconPlus } from "@tabler/icons-react";
import styles from "./CardTags.module.css"; import styles from "./CardTags.module.css";
@@ -63,8 +63,8 @@ const CardTags = ({ tags, cardId, groupId }: Props) => {
<Checkbox <Checkbox
checked={!!tags.find(cardTag => cardTag.id === tag.id)} checked={!!tags.find(cardTag => cardTag.id === tag.id)}
onClick={(event) => onTagClick(tag, event)} onClick={(event) => onTagClick(tag, event)}
label={tag.name}
/> />
<Text>{tag.name}</Text>
</Group> </Group>
))} ))}
</Stack> </Stack>

View File

@@ -11,6 +11,7 @@
flex-direction: column; flex-direction: column;
/*background-color: red;*/ /*background-color: red;*/
height: 100%; height: 100%;
margin-top: 8px;
} }
.items-list::after { .items-list::after {

View File

@@ -1,4 +1,4 @@
import { FC, useState } from "react"; import { FC, useMemo, useState } from "react";
import { useCardSummaries } from "../hooks/useCardSummaries.tsx"; import { useCardSummaries } from "../hooks/useCardSummaries.tsx";
import PageBlock from "../../../components/PageBlock/PageBlock.tsx"; import PageBlock from "../../../components/PageBlock/PageBlock.tsx";
import CardEditDrawer from "../drawers/CardEditDrawer/CardEditDrawer.tsx"; import CardEditDrawer from "../drawers/CardEditDrawer/CardEditDrawer.tsx";
@@ -25,18 +25,22 @@ export const CardsPage: FC = () => {
const [displayMode, setDisplayMode] = useState<DisplayMode>(DisplayMode.BOARD); const [displayMode, setDisplayMode] = useState<DisplayMode>(DisplayMode.BOARD);
const tableBody = ( const tableBody = useMemo(() => {
<CardsTable items={data} /> return (
); <CardsTable items={data} />
);
}, [data]);
const boardsBody = ( const boardsBody = useMemo(() => {
<DndContextProvider return (
summariesRaw={summariesRaw} <DndContextProvider
refetchSummaries={refetchSummaries} summariesRaw={summariesRaw}
> refetchSummaries={refetchSummaries}
<Boards /> >
</DndContextProvider> <Boards />
); </DndContextProvider>
);
}, [summariesRaw]);
const getBody = () => { const getBody = () => {
return ( return (